HB0179 Summary
-
Requires municipalities to print each taxing district affected by tax increment financing (TIF) revenues on property tax bills or separate statements mailed with bills.
-
Strengthens "blighted area" definition by requiring that factors be present to a "meaningful extent" and "reasonably distributed" throughout the area, with documentation that public intervention is necessary to address each factor.
-
Prohibits designating areas within existing redevelopment project areas as blighted areas under TIF programs.
-
Requires municipalities to reevaluate blighted area designations every 10 years after initial adoption and either redesignate or discontinue the redevelopment project area based on current conditions.
-
Limits municipalities from jointly undertaking TIF plans or utilizing revenues across contiguous redevelopment areas to property within one mile of the border where areas are contiguous (with exceptions for existing arrangements).
